Instagram Updates Wordmark Logo
Social media giant Instagram has updated its wordmark logo for the first time in a decade. Meta, Instagram’s parent company, has refined the typography in the new logo to make it look more modern, clear, and streamlined.
Instagram Head Adam Mosseri officially unveiled the new wordmark across Instagram and Threads. According to Mosseri, the updated design preserves the core identity of the original logo while making the lettering cleaner, more contemporary, and visually engaging.
What Has Changed in the New Wordmark?
The new wordmark retains Instagram’s familiar script style, but adjustments have been made to the sizing and structure of the letters. Notably, the redesign of certain characters has caught the attention of users worldwide.
Moseri noted that the wordmark displayed within the app had remained largely unchanged for nearly 10 years, prompting a timely refresh to match modern aesthetic standards. He emphasized that the new design successfully balances Instagram’s classic identity with improved simplicity.
A Look Back at Past Changes
Instagram last introduced a massive overhaul to its overall brand design back in 2016. During that redesign, the company replaced its classic retro brown camera icon and rainbow stripe with the vibrant, pink-gradient camera icon currently familiar to millions.
User Reception and Scope of the Update
Following the rollout of the new wordmark, user reactions have been mixed. While some users have welcomed the fresh, modern, and sleek design, others have expressed disappointment with the alterations.
It is worth noting that the core app icon remains unchanged. This update focuses strictly on the wordmark used across app branding and marketing platforms.
